1 Peter 1:13

Therefore gird up the loins of your mind, be sober, and rest your hope fully upon the grace that is to be brought to you at the revelation of Jesus Christ.

Heavenly Father, 
I pray we do not confuse holiness with morality. Understanding that morality is outward conformance to a set of standards, but holiness is the inward transformation, the cleanliness of our soul's as we submit to live in obedience to Your will. By the power of Your Holy Spirit we can exercise self-control, a wonderful fruit of Your Spirit. Disciplining our minds to be sober in our thoughts and actions. I pray we would not be inebriated with the cares of this life that choke out Your word, and make it unfruitful. May we be self-denying and on guard to temptation, foolish and hurtful lusts and let us not be intoxicated by false doctrine that lulls us to sleep, rendering us incapable of serving You and Your church. I pray Lord that we would abstain from being enthralled by fables that are contrary to Your words of truth. Father thank You for the revelation of Your Son Jesus Christ, who through His sacrifice gave an electing grace, redeeming grace and justifying grace, adopting grace, so none of us can boast in the work that we have done. Open the eyes of those who still live groping in the darkness, and cleanse the eyes that are haughty and think more of themselves than they ought. Father thank You that we may rest fully upon Your grace, unearned, unmerited but lovingly bestowed upon us. Lord may I live a life pleasing and acceptable in Your sight. Adhering to Your teachings, honoring You not only with my lips but my whole heart as well. In Jesus name, Amen.
